The '''P. A. Stolypin Medal''' ({{langx|ru|Медаль Столыпина П. А.|Medal Stolypina P. A.}}) is an award of the Government of the Russian Federation. It was established on 26 May 2008 by Decree No. 388 of the Government of the Russian Federation, "On the P.A. Stolypin Medal."<ref>{{cite web|url=https://www.kommersant.ru/doc/1006381|title=Правительство России учредило медаль имени П.А. Столыпина|publisher=Kommersant|accessdate=11 January 2026|date=28 May 2008 |language=Russian}}</ref> The medal is awarded in two classes, the first and the second.<ref name="minobrnauki">{{cite web|url=https://www.minobrnauki.gov.ru/action/awardpolicy/government/|title=Медаль Столыпина П.А., Почетная грамота Правительства Российской Федерации и Благодарность Правительства Российской Федерации|publisher=Ministry of Education and Science (Russia)|accessdate=11 January 2026|language=Russian}}</ref>
==Statute of the medal== The medal is awarded for "achievements in addressing strategic socioeconomic development objectives, including the implementation of long-term projects of the Government of the Russian Federation in industry, agriculture, construction, transport, science, education, healthcare, culture, and other areas."<ref name="minobrnauki"/> Eligible individuals must have at least 10 years of public service or at least 15 years of professional experience.<ref name="pg">{{cite web|url=https://www.pnp.ru/social/pravitelstvo-izmenilo-pravila-nagrazhdeniya-medalyu-pa-stolypina.html|title=Правительство изменило правила награждения медалью П.А. Столыпина|first=Maria |last=Sokolova|publisher=Parlamentskaya Gazeta |accessdate=11 January 2026|date=30 June 2020|language=Russian}}</ref> It is named for Pyotr Stolypin, Chairman of the Council of Ministers between 1906 and 1911.<ref name="pg"/>
The regulations were amended on 25 December 2019; establishing that the first-class medal could be awarded to recipients who had not previously received the second-class medal.<ref>{{cite web|url=https://ria.ru/20191225/1562825048.html|title=Медведев изменил порядок награждения медалью Столыпина|publisher=RIA Novosti|accessdate=11 January 2026|date=25 December 2019|language=Russian}}</ref> They were again amended on 30 June 2020; establishing that nominations for the medal are submitted by government ministers, heads of federal government agencies, and senior officials of the federal subjects of Russia, and to allow its award to citizens who have received government letters of commendation and honorary diplomas.<ref name="pg"/> The medal is awarded by the Prime Minister of Russia, or by other high-ranking officials as they direct.<ref name="pg"/>
==Description== The Stolypin Medal is 34mm in diameter and made of brass, the first-class medal is gold-plated, the second-class medal is silver-plated. The obverse features a relief bust of Pyotr Stolypin, with the raised inscription "FOR THE GLORY OF RUSSIA, FOR THE BENEFIT OF RUSSIANS", ({{langx|ru|ВО СЛАВУ РОССИИ, ВО БЛАГО РОССИЯН|VO SLAVU ROSSII, VO BLAGO ROSSIYAN}}) along the upper edge, and "STOLYPIN P.A." ({{langx|ru|СТОЛЫПИН П.А.}}) along the lower edge. The reverse features the raised inscription "GOVERNMENT OF THE RUSSIAN FEDERATION" ({{langx|ru|ПРАВИТЕЛЬСТВО РОССИЙСКОЙ ФЕДЕРАЦИИ|PRAVITELSTVO ROSSIYSKOY FEDERATSII}}) and the number of the award. The medal is attached with a loop and ring to a rectangular medal bar, covered with a blue silk moiré ribbon. Attached to the medal bar is an image of a double-headed eagle holding crossed scepters in its claws.<ref name="rt">{{cite web|url=https://rus.team/articles/medal-stolypina-p-a|title=Медаль Столыпина П.А.|publisher=rus.team|accessdate=11 January 2026|language=Russian}}</ref>

==History== The second-class medal was first awarded to German Gref, president of Sberbank, on 8 February 2009. Gref had previously been Minister of Economic Development and Trade.<ref>{{cite web|url=https://www.kommersant.ru/doc/1122052|title=Путин наградил Грефа медалью Столыпина II степени|publisher=Kommersant|accessdate=11 January 2026|date=11 February 2009|language=Russian}}</ref> The first-class medal was first awarded to Alexey Gordeyev, Minister of Agriculture, on 5 March 2009.<ref>{{cite web|url=https://ria.ru/20090305/163981995.html|title=Гордеев награжден медалью Столыпина|publisher=RIA Novosti|accessdate=11 January 2026|date=5 March 2009|language=Russian}}</ref>
